Pros
- Compact, slim design
- Good image quality in automatic mode
Cons
- Image quality suffers above ISO 200
- Viewfinder is too small to actually use
Bottom Line
The SD1200 IS has a variety of shooting modes and great image quality, but some design flaws hamper it a bit.
